Crockpot Beef Stew Recipe

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 10 hours
Total Time 10 hours 20 minutes
Servings 6 servings
Calories 450
A hearty and flavorful beef stew cooked slowly to tender perfection, perfect for cozy dinners.

Ingredients

olive oil

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il (divided)

beef cubes

  • 2 pounds boneless stewing beef cubes (or chuck)
  • 0.5 medium onion medium onion (chopped)
  • 6 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 pound Yukon Gold potatoes (peeled & diced)
  • 4 large large carrots (peeled & cut into large pieces)
  • 3 stalks celery (chopped)
  • 3 cups beef broth
  • 6 ounces tomato paste (see note)
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• to taste pepper
  • 3 bay leaves bay leaves
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ch (optional)

Instructions 

  • Sear half the beef in 1 tablespoon of oil until browned, then transfer to the slow cooker. Repeat with remaining beef.
  • Cook onion in skillet for 3-4 minutes, add garlic, then transfer to the slow cooker.
  • Add remaining ingredients (except bay leaves and cornstarch) to the slow cooker and stir well.
  • Add bay leaves, cook on low for 10 hours until beef is tender.
  • Optional: Mix cornstarch with cold water, stir into stew, and cook for 10 minutes to thicken.

Notes

For a thicker stew, add cornstarch mixture at the end.
